Follower of Thomas Gainsborough, R.A.
An extensive wooded landscape, with figures in the foreground and a lake beyond
with signature 'Thos Gainsborough' (lower left)
oil on canvas
30½ x 40 in. (77.5 x 101.7 cm.)
An extensive wooded landscape, with figures in the foreground and a lake beyond
with signature 'Thos Gainsborough' (lower left)
oil on canvas
30½ x 40 in. (77.5 x 101.7 cm.)
Provenance
with Ehrich Galleries, New York, c. 1920, from whom purchased by Anderson Galleries, New York.
Purchased from the above by Mrs Moses J. Wentworth.
Purchased, through Anderson Galleries, by Clement Studebaker, Jr., of Chicago, in April 1928.
Purchased, through Anderson Galleries, by Ralph Norton, on 9 March 1936.
Sold by the Norton Museum in Palm Beach, Florida, in 1971, to Mr and Mrs Harwell Mosely, Winter Park, Florida.

Literature
J. Hayes, The Landscape Paintings of Thomas Gainsborough, London, 1982, I, p. 251, pl. 290, as by Francis Towne.
